Amazeballs 😻. We ordered half a charcoal chicken and the mixed meat platter; both incredible in terms of taste and value. Each came with a generous serving of garlic dip and Lebanese bread. The service was warm, friendly, and prompt as our food was ready within 15 minutes. The mixed platter came with 4 meats (chicken, prawn, lamb and kofta). Our personal favourites were the lamb and kofta, but the chicken and prawn were delicious as well. The meats were cooked perfectly, juicy and tender, and had a slight char to it (which we really enjoyed). The hummus and garlic dip paired perfectly with the meat, the salad and the biryani rice. The charcoal chicken was surprisingly delightful. It definitely packed in the charcoal flavour that we were hoping for. The bread that came with both meals was thin and tasty, even by itself. All in all, definitely one of the better Middle-Eastern restaurants we've dined at 😸.

This is a real authentic Middle Eastern food specialist & kebab experience run by a wonderful Syrian family. The food is home made and delicious! The home-made chili sauce and garlic yogurt sauce are refreshing and beautifully seasoned and go so well with the perfectly grill-roasted meats and fresh salads. The kebabs are in fresh pita bread and toasted in a sandwich press. Served in a foil-lined bag so no horrible spills 😉😀 Everything is clean, air-conditioned and relaxed. The service is great and authentic. Lots of local customers and plenty of space. There is a wide selection of food on the menu. See the photos of the food boards. Toilets are easily available. Indie and outdoor seating with plenty free of parking. I thoroughly enjoy this place. Highly recommend

They have the most wonderful warm and generous hospitality, and they communicate kindly and helpfully as you order and wait. They have a wide variety of options at a very reasonable price ticket. I enjoyed the flavours. However I ordered and two orders that were after mine were served before mine and when mine did come it was cold and clearly looked like it had been sitting there a while. Perhaps they were cooking my partner’s food after they’d cooked mine but mine was disappointing from the stale and coldness of it. I will say they’re cream garlic sauce and hummus is heaven on earth. I think I will be back but will remind them I would like my food hot so they don’t forget about my food again.
